[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[piecepack] Re: Interesting piecepack project -- want to help?



I think the idea is great, and it would be excellent if it could be somehow integrated into the wiki. Then showing examples would be so easy...

-Jorge

On Mar 5, 2007, at 11:03 PM, porter235 wrote:

A natural match indeed. I was inspired by board2diag, but will
definitely be working from scratch. Licensing is one issue, as well I
am thinking of a slightly more modern approach...

You would include in your html a chunk like

<pre class="ppdiag">
   +     +     +        +
			      +
+     +     +     +     +
			      +
5C    AC    NC:d  +     +

+     +           +     +

-----
cC 6,1.5 45 ul

</pre>


on load the javascript would find all class="ppdiag" and rerender them
as pretty graphic versions. The cryptic line would place a coin of
Crowns on 6 column, 1.5 row angled 45deg(0= straight up) shifted to
the upper left corner of the tile.

NC:d is the Null of Crowns facing "down" or south.

This way the basic board layouts can be "drawn" in ascii and then
coins, dice, pawns, and other markers could be added on top.

So far this is only the product of a brain storm and it is yet to see
if this is possible or desirable. Thoughts?

JCD

--- In piecepack@yahoogroups.com, "Ron Hale-Evans" <rwhe@...> wrote:

Oh, hey, Jon! Well, I'd say you're in a good position to create this
software, since you've been working so long with the JCD graphics,
Vassal, and so on.

The benefit of writing it from scratch is that you could use a free
license like the GNU GPL. The board2diag license doesn't even say you
can modify it, so you'd have to ask the authors for permission. That
kind of thing might cramp people writing free rules for the piecepack.

Ron



------------------------ Yahoo! Groups Sponsor -------------------- ~-->
Yahoo! Groups gets a make over. See the new email design.
http://us.click.yahoo.com/hOt0.A/lOaOAA/yQLSAA/grQolB/TM
-------------------------------------------------------------------- ~->


Yahoo! Groups Links